Hawkeye ATD's Building Community Connections Conference (formerly known as Non-Profit Training Day) is an award-winning event where we give back to the community. This conference is great for staff, volunteers, and board members of non-profits, employees with talent development as a small portion of their role, and individuals who are new to talent development or looking for a fresh perspective.
Join us for an informative, fun, and energizing day that will help you better support talent development efforts. Your registration includes access to an expert panel, three breakout sessions of your choice, lunch and snacks, and chances to win door prizes. The day will wrap up with the opportunity to connect with ATD Members to learn how they can volunteer or offer pro-bono services to help you develop talent at nonprofit organizations.
